Tiruvarur district registers 85 pass per centage

May 23, 2014 01:41 pm | Updated November 17, 2021 04:52 am IST - TIRUVARUR

Tiruvarur district registered 84.13 pass per centage in the SSLC public examinations. Of the 18,560 students from 203 schools – boys 8,977 and girls 9,583 – who appeared for the examinations, 15,615 candidates – boys 7,233 and girls 8,382 – emerged successful.

Three students – C. Janani Sri (Sri Bharathidasan Matriculation Higher Secondary School, Mannarguri), K. Nuzaifath Nisha (St. Theresa’s Girls HSS, Tiruthuraipoondi) and P. Shivani (R. C. Fathima Matriculation School, Tiruvarur) – tallied 497 marks each to finish joint district toppers.

Six students – K. Balasundari (Rahmath Girls Matriculation HSS, Muthupettai), S. R. Mohanapriya and S. K. Sushmitha (both St. Josephs Girls HSS, Mannargudi), A. Raihanah Thasleem (St. Theresa’s Girls HSS, Tiruthuraipoondi), R. Ranjitha (Devi Matriculation HSS, Melamaravakadu), S. J. Yogha (Sairam Matriculation HSS, Tiruthuraipoondi) – were joint district second with a tally of 496 each.

ADVERTISEMENT

Six students finished district third totalling 495 marks each: S. Archana (Sri Shanmuka Matriculation HSS, Mannargudi), K. Arulmozhi (Devi Matriculationi HSS, Melamaravakkadu), A. Nabila Jafrana (St. Theresa’s Girls HSS, Thiruthuraipoondi), M. Suriyaprakash (Nava Bharath Matriculation HSS, Ullikottai), S. Swane (The Merit HSS, Senthamangalam) and B. Varshapoorani (Sri Sankara Matriculation HSS, Peralam).
